Have you ever felt like the ground was shifting beneath your feet? This beautiful quote by Victor Hugo reminds us that even when our foundations feel shaky or the support we rely on seems to disappear, we possess an inherent strength that can carry us through. It is about the profound realization that our true stability doesn't come from the branches we land on, but from the strength of our own wings. There is a certain magic in finding your voice even when you feel completely unsupported by the world around you.

In our daily lives, we often seek certainty. We look for stable jobs, steady relationships, and predictable routines to feel safe. But life has a way of presenting us with boughs that are far too slight for our weight. We might face a sudden change in a career path, a friendship that drifts away, or a plan that falls apart at the last minute. In those moments, it is so easy to let fear take over and assume that because the branch is breaking, we are destined to fall.
